Chicago Bulls blow 21-point lead to Detroit Pistons

The Chicago Bulls came out swinging, as they completely dominated the first half, as the team led by as much as 21 points. However, the Pistons mounted a major comeback to take back control of the game. The game was close up to the end, but Blake Griffin’s dominant play in the 4th quarter was too much for the Bulls to handle. The All-Star forward finished with 27 points.

Andre Drummond and Reggie Jackson also gave the young Bulls a rough go, as Drummond posted a 20 point, 24 rebound game, while Jackson put up a respectable 21 points as well.
